East Indian Rosewood Bowl Blank – Premium Exotic Hardwood for Turning

Turn heirloom-quality bowls with our East Indian Rosewood Bowl Blank, a world-renowned exotic hardwood prized for its deep chocolate-brown color, striking dark veining, and exceptional density. Known scientifically as Dalbergia latifolia, East Indian Rosewood is highly valued by professional woodturners, luthiers, and fine craftsmen for its stability, durability, and luxurious finish.

Each bowl blank is carefully selected and precision-cut to ensure reliable turning performance on the lathe. The dense, tight grain allows for clean cuts, crisp details, and smooth curves. When finished, East Indian Rosewood develops a rich, natural sheen that enhances its dramatic grain patterns, making every turned piece truly unique.

Key Features:

  • Wood Species: East Indian Rosewood (Dalbergia latifolia)

  • Type: Exotic hardwood bowl blank

  • Grain: Fine, tight, straight to slightly interlocked

  • Color: Deep brown with dark purple-black streaks

  • Density: Very hard, heavy, and wear-resistant

  • Finish Quality: Polishes to a smooth, high-gloss surface

Why Choose East Indian Rosewood Bowl Blanks?

East Indian Rosewood is renowned for its dimensional stability, strength, and visual depth. Its natural oils enhance finish quality while providing long-term durability. Compared to many domestic hardwoods, it offers superior weight, elegance, and longevity—perfect for statement bowls and collectible pieces.
